UNIFIED CARRIER REGISTRATION PLAN


Sunshine Act Meetings

TIME AND DATE: January 25, 2024, 12:00 p.m. to 3:00 p.m., Eastern Time.

PLACE: This meeting will be accessible via conference call and via Zoom 
Meeting and Screenshare. Any interested person may call (i) 1-929-205-
6099 (US Toll) or 1-669-900-6833 (US Toll), Meeting ID: 949 7520 9962, 
to listen and participate in this meeting. The website to participate 
via Zoom Meeting and Screenshare is <a href="https://kellen.zoom.us/meeting/register/tJAkcOyqrjIjHNZzp3Zo54X-XjrybypgFcDG">https://kellen.zoom.us/meeting/register/tJAkcOyqrjIjHNZzp3Zo54X-XjrybypgFcDG</a>.

STATUS: This meeting will be open to the public.

MATTERS TO BE CONSIDERED: The Unified Carrier Registration Plan Dispute 
Resolution Subcommittee (the ``Subcommittee'') will conduct a meeting 
to continue its work in developing and implementing the Unified Carrier 
Registration Plan and Agreement. The subject matter of this meeting 
will include:

IV. Review of the Process and Policy of Resolving Disputes Under the 
Unified Carrier Registration Agreement--UCR Dispute Resolution 
Subcommittee Chair, UCR Chief Legal Officer, UCR Executive Director

    The UCR Dispute Resolution Subcommittee Chair, UCR Chief Legal 
Officer, and UCR Executive Director will review the current process and 
Policy of Resolving Disputes Under the Unified Carrier Registration 
Agreement.

V. Review of the Process and Policy of Resolving Disputes Under the 
Unified Carrier Registration Agreement as They Pertain to Disputes 
Filed by the Small Business in Transportation Coalition--UCR Dispute 
Resolution Subcommittee Chair, UCR Chief Legal Officer, UCR Executive 
Director

For Discussion and Possible Subcommittee Action

    The UCR Dispute Resolution Subcommittee Chair, UCR Chief Legal 
Officer, and UCR Executive Director will review the current process and 
Policy of Resolving Disputes Under the Unified Carrier Registration 
Agreement in the context of three pending requests for dispute 
resolution filed by the Small Business in Transportation Coalition 
(``SBTC''). The Subcommittee may discuss the issue of jurisdiction over 
each of the three requests by the SBTC and the role of the Subcommittee 
in preparing these requests for hearing by the Board.
    The Subcommittee may also discuss the possibility of hiring a 
Hearing Officer employed for the purpose of assisting the Subcommittee 
and the Board in the process of hearing requests for dispute resolution 
brought to the Board.
    The Subcommittee may also discuss and recommend to the Board one or 
more proposed changes to the current Dispute Resolution Policy.
